The value of +the variable is set by querying the current elapsed wall time of the +simulation. This is done at the point in time when the variable is +defined in the input script. If a second timer-style variable is also +defined, then a simple formula can be used to calculate the elapsed time +between the two timers, as in the example at the top of this manual +entry. As mentioned above, timer-style variables can be redefined +elsewhere in the input script, so the same pair of variables can be used +in a loop or to time a series of operations.
